Apologies if this has been asked recently - but what is the difference between fully fitted and regular fit shirts.

I presume that fully fitted is a more tailored slightly more fitting style, but not like a slim fit - or is it something totally different?

John Francomb

hi Gavin,

This is something we get a lot of questions about. We do 3 body fits - regular, slim fit and fully fitted and there are slight differences in the chest and waist measurements in each fit. Our regular fit is a more generous cut with more fabric around the waist. If you like your shirt a bit closer fitting, our slim fit is probably the right fit for you. Fully fitted is slightly slimmer still. The best thing to do would be to work from your collar size and see where your waist and chest measurements fit best on our shirt sizing charts to see which shirt styles would fit you best.
